The Target of Sight Word Reading Passages

Free printable sight word reading passages are designed to help children learn to read in a way that's fun and engaging. These resources use a combination of sight words, which are words that children should recognize on sight, and simple sentences to help children learn to read in a way that's easy and effective.

How to Use Sight Word Reading Passages Effectively

The key to using sight word reading passages effectively is to make the process as fun and engaging as possible. Try using a variety of different passages, including stories, poems, and non-fiction articles, to keep children interested in reading. Additionally, be sure to provide plenty of positive feedback and praise to help encourage children as they learn to read.
